Maintenance Mechanic
Troubleshooting and Maintenance
Troubleshoot, repair, and maintain hydraulic systems, pneumatic actuators, conveyor networks, and three-phase motors.
Perform routine preventive maintenance inspections according to our CMMS schedule.
Maintain and repair utility and facility-related equipment as directed by the Maintenance Supervisor.
Diagnose basic electrical and PLC faults using schematic blueprints and digital.
Respond rapidly to emergency production line breakdowns to minimize operational downtime.
Assisting and training other maintenance personnel with repairs, preventive maintenance, and rebuilds.
Collaborating closely with production and other departments to proactively resolve equipment issues.
Maintaining a safe, clean, and organized work area.
Qualifications
Strong mechanical aptitude with systematic troubleshooting abilities.
Experience with PLC troubleshooting, industrial controls, and motor controls (strong plus).
Comfortable using mechanical lifts and ladders, and with kneeling, bending, and twisting; able to lift up to 50 lbs.
Work independently, prioritize and manage multiple tasks, and are willing to work an off-shift position with rotating shifts and overtime, including weekends.
